Come Meizu e MediaTek hanno reso uno dei maggior parte degli smartphone potenti su Android
Consigli / / December 19, 2019
In uno dei posti che abbiamo già parlato dello smartphone Meizu MX4, di alta qualità e relativamente poco costoso ammiraglia cinese, che può essere chiamato uno dei migliori e più potenti smartphone nel 2014. In questo post, abbiamo deciso di indagare, a causa della quale lo smartphone cinese a basso costo è diventato così produttivo.
Otto core - lusso o necessità?
Altri 3-4 anni fa, smartphone otto processori sarebbe percepito come un lusso o addirittura uno scherzo, ma oggi è il numero di core è giustificata - fornisce la flessibilità necessaria per controllare il funzionamento dello smartphone.
E non è limitata ad un solo spettacolo, allo stesso tempo, perché la necessità smartphone chipset di cercare un equilibrio tra potenza, calore e unità di potenza. Due o quattro core chiaramente non abbastanza, quando il dispositivo mobile deve adattarsi alle centinaia e migliaia di carichi "Shades". E le risorse in modo più accurato il processore seleziona per compiti specifici, per meglio osservare lo stesso equilibrio.
Il Meizu MX4 installato chipset MediaTek MT6595 con una grande architettura. PICCOLO. Questo permette al processore di includere un certo numero di core "piccoli" per compiti semplici (musica, navigazione web) e "grande" per i più esigenti processi (3D-giochi, la riproduzione di video 4K). L'uso di questo principio è illustrato nello schema seguente: nucleo economico elimina inutile consumo della batteria in applicazioni semplici.
Tuttavia, grande. PICCOLO sé non è una panacea - è importante, in una qualsiasi delle tre opzioni sarà attuato.
Come eterogeneo sistema aumenta la produttività
E 'il più semplice grande variazione. PICCOLO chiama "migrazione del cluster". Ciò significa che nucleo bassa potenza non può funzionare contemporaneamente con il produttivo, loro intersezione è possibile. Questo metodo è stato utilizzato nel primo al mondo "otto» Exynos 5 Octa 5410 in Samsung Galaxy S IV.
Lo schema di cui sopra, si noterà un difetto così difficile distinzione: il processore perde serio potenziale di ottimizzazione delle prestazioni "sul raccordo" nuclei di diversa architettura.
Il MediaTek MT6595 respinto tali variazioni e scegliere il cosiddetto sistema eterogeneo. Ora, il cuore di ogni architettura può lavorare in qualsiasi combinazione. In realtà, il processore eterogeneo è diventato il primo al mondo MediaTek MT8135, pubblicato nel luglio 2013.
MediaTek si avvicinò al problema completo, chiamando la sua CorePilot tecnologia, la cui missione - di uccidere almeno due piccioni con una fava. Da un lato, per rendere il processore più potente, dall'altro - non girare lo smartphone viene scaricata in 20 minuti e caldo come un ferro da stiro, un giocattolo. Aiutare questa evoluzione del marchio all'interno CorePilot.
La tecnologia continua a "tre pilastri":
- il sistema di alimentazione e processore termico basato sul controllo tensione e frequenza dei nuclei.
- Algoritmo adattivo gestione termica (ATM). Un po 'più tardi, ci concentreremo su più.
- RT Scheduler e HMP Scheduler - schedulatori proprio compito MediaTek per distribuire correttamente il carico tra più core di diverse architetture in diversi fasci. Ad esempio, se i taiwanesi hanno approfittato di standard di Linux-pianificatore, è l'uso di otto core sarebbe davvero abbastanza. Anche perché che CorePilot non solo selezionare singolarmente le risorse per i compiti, ma anche di cambiare la frequenza di ciascun core, a seconda della situazione.
Esame dettagliato CorePilot beneficiare ogni aspetto possibile dedicare un libro a parte, così andiamo dritti al punto e Esaminiamo un esempio concreto.
ATM per elevate prestazioni senza surriscaldamento
In processori per dispositivi mobili, e l'uso del computer un meccanismo chiamato "throttling" (da non confondere con il "trolling"!). Quando il processore sta lavorando duro, la sua temperatura aumenta, che alla fine può portare al surriscaldamento. Per evitare questo, una volta raggiunta una certa picco di temperatura è attivato strozzamento - forza potenza di elaborazione è limitata, il che riduce le prestazioni, ma consente raffreddarlo.
Il problema è che soglia solito rigidamente specificato, per esempio, 70 o 80 gradi Celsius. In CorePilot detta tecnica ATM, al contrario, agisce in modo flessibile e insiemi "corridoio temperatura" per la gestione dinamica situazione senza limitazione tagliente.
Come risultato, le prestazioni del processore è migliorata del 10% rispetto ad un sistema di controllo di temperatura convenzionale.
Sembra che il 10% - non è tanto, ma a causa di simili sciocchezze e dei benefici della linea MediaTek MT6595. Consumo totale di energia a seconda della modalità è ridotto del 20% e le prestazioni sono migliorate del 20%.
Non da ultimo a migliorare la produttività e pianificatori giocare MediaTek.
Produttori Meizu MX4 verificato il lavoro di diversi gestori: il suo proprietario e di serie sullo stesso processore, anche se non un otto, e quad - MediaTek MT 8135. La differenza è impressionante in termini di prestazioni - vedi metriche come i diversi nei benchmark.
Superiorità di prestazioni è ovvio, ma allo stesso tempo e il consumo di energia ridotto.
Il Cortex-A17 e prestazioni record nuova architettura
Oltre al cluster di quattro core ARM Cortex-A7 (1,7 GHz), in un otto processore MediaTek MT6595 prima volta nel mondo utilizzata architettura del kernel ARM Cortex-A17. affermazioni ARM a strapiombo che Cortex-A17 il 60% più forte precursore rappresentato Cortex-A9 e il 20% - Cortex-A15. Sembra abbastanza realistica, almeno nel detto proprio all'inizio, perché - in mega benchmark AnTuTu smartphone Meizu MX4 guadagnando quasi 50.000 punti.
Meizu MX4 nel presente e nel futuro
Naturalmente, le prestazioni Meizu MX4 può essere più alto - a 52.000 punti, ma si tratta di una media calcolata durante la prova. Immaginate che con le impostazioni grafiche più elevate giocato Asphalt 8 mezz'ora. In tali condizioni, naturalmente funziona allo stesso strozzamento, che ridurrà i progressi nel AnTuTu. Pertanto, il rendimento medio e inferiore. Tuttavia, con gli altri membri rango di atti come sistema di conteggio, e tutti gli indicatori sono ottenuti inferiore al massimo possibile.
Ai primi di febbraio, ARM ha introdotto una nuova generazione di top-end a 64 bit CPU Cortex-A72, che è 3,5 volte più potente del Cortex-A15 e può essere utilizzato in base alla grande. PICCOLO insieme conveniente Cortex-A53. Anno sarà sicuramente interessante - stoccaggio popcorn e preparatevi a guardare i produttori di chip di battaglia.